Hurrem Sultan was one of the most powerful and influential women in Ottoman history as well as a prominent and controversial figure during the era known as the Sultanate of Women.
Young Anastasia, daughter of a priest from Rohatyn, western Ukraine, was taken prisoner and brought to Istanbul. There, the girl was lucky to be bought from the slave traders by the sultan's best friend and faithful associate, Ibrahim Pasha of Parga, who presented her to Suleiman as a gift in honor of the sultan's ascension to the throne.
Now part of the harem, the young captive immediately receives a new name - Hurrem, which in Persian means "one who brings joy" or "the cheerful one" and perfectly highlights the girl's cheerful character.
Soon, charming Hurrem manages to become Sultan Suleiman's consort and favorite.
